Need to post up pics. It is common for the chassis to be a model year prior to the motorhome build year. Easy to correct at the DVM with a window sticker from the manufacturer. You should be able to call them and get them to email it to you.
 
Just look a the VIN# the 10th digit from left to right will tell the year of the truck, 2007 will be 7, 2008 will be 8

Not on RVs. It is common for the chassis VIN to be a year, even two, before the manufacturer date on the house. A LOT of this happened when DEF was added to the chassis, the manufacturers stocked up on chassis before the requirement took effect. My chassis VIN is 2007 but built as a 2008, easily fixed at the DMV.
